The training budget proposal for next year at Hollin & Marsh Consulting allocates funds across three streams: analyst certification, the Birchway leadership programme, and compliance refreshers. The certification stream grows 12% to cover the new Danvers practice. Compliance spend holds flat; leadership spend shifts toward internal delivery after mixed results with external providers in Exley. Department heads have signed off on allocations pending your review. A short confidential note on related business plans is appended below.

board note of tadup-tajog: Headcount on the Oliiel team goes from 31 to 88 by the end of February. Gross margin on Oliiel came in at 62 percent against a plan of 29 percent.

## Formula sandbox tuning

User-supplied formulas in Gridmoor execute inside a restricted interpreter with hard ceilings on time, memory, and call depth. Reviewers should confirm any change to these ceilings is justified in the PR description, since raising them widens the abuse surface. Defaults were chosen from production traces. The current limits are as follows.

limits module of tafog-fawip:
WEIGHTS = {
    "julix": 57,
    "lamys": 992,
    "kasvan": 209,
    "quenok": 750,
    "alddor": 259,
    "oliath": 1009,
    "wenix": 815,
}

## Step 4: Port the nightly cron jobs to Flowhenge

Alright, future maintainers, this is the fiddly bit. Each legacy cron entry becomes a Flowhenge workflow definition with an explicit schedule trigger — no more guessing which box a job ran on. Keep the old crontab commented out for one full cycle so you can diff outputs before deleting anything. Retries are handled by the engine now, so strip any hand-rolled retry loops from the scripts. The workflow runner expects the following configuration values.

deployment values, yagaf-tawif:
[zorael]
team = pelix
access_code = ac_be383e
host = zorael.tolvaqio.internal
port = 8080
owner = druath.ulador
peer = fendor.tolvaqcorp.corp